Summary:
Climate Action is an international communication platform established by Sustainable Development International in partnership with the United Nations Environment Program (UNEP) to educate businesses, governments and NGOs as to what they can do to reduce their carbon footprint and adapt to the impacts of climate change. Further, the high-profile publication and supporting website will assist institutional investors in analyzing and comparing companies that are responding to the business risks and opportunities resulting from global warming.--Publisher's description.
